The MATLAB Technology Tour 2011 is a series of free, one-day events held throughout Australia in May.
Each event includes a keynote, technical presentations, real-world case studies, product demonstrations, and in-depth workshops. Whether you are new to MATLAB® and Simulink® or use it every day, you'll leave with new knowledge and skills you can start applying immediately.The tour dates and locations are:

While not the focus of this seminar, B&R Automation's Automation Studio Target for Simulink makes use of the Matlab Simulink product to facilitate automatic code generation, an in-practice application of the concepts addressed in the seminar. Daanet staff will manning an information booth at the MATLAB Technology Tour 2011 event, and able to discuss the integration of Matlab and B&R products.
